## Step 4: Pin the Component Library Version

Before upgrading Lanternkit past v5, pin every consuming app to the 4.x line in its manifest. Mixed major versions cause duplicate style injection at runtime. The registry mirror at Harwick Labs tracks which teams have migrated. Once pinned, verify the audit table in the shared metadata store using the connection below.

warehouse DSN: mssql://rusdor_svc:0FSWCn9@db-951a.paliqforge.local:5432/ulawyn

### Account Recovery — Billing Worker (Blue-Green)

If the Tindervale billing worker's deploy account is locked mid-rollout, do not flip traffic; both blue and green pools must stay as-is until access is restored. Release managers should first verify which pool holds the active queue lease, then initiate recovery from the Cobalt console's operator tab. Recovery re-issues the worker credential to both pools atomically, so no replays occur. The console's recovery prompt accepts the passphrase shown immediately below this section.

recovery phrase for bawep-kawef: oliath-casdor

Subject: Key rotation for the Stormcrier fan-out service

Hi support team,

Tonight we are rotating the credential the Stormcrier weather-alert fan-out uses to publish to the Beaconreach notification bus. Expect a brief pause in alert delivery between 01:00 and 01:15 while pods restart; queued alerts will flush automatically afterward. If customers report missing alerts after 01:30, escalate to platform on-call rather than retrying manually. For your troubleshooting console, the replacement key is below.

app token of bahaf-tajeg = zpat23_SjjsllwiLmXbtS65veZaV47

**Visitor policy: Secure interview room (Room 4A, Pellwick Wing)**

All after-hours candidate interviews take place in Room 4A, which remains locked at all times. Night shift staff must verify the interviewer's name against the evening schedule before admitting anyone, and visitors must be accompanied continuously — no exceptions, even for brief absences. Log entry and exit times in the desk register. The room is opened using the code below.

turnstile pass: bdg-QZV-3